WebThe new amendment now specifies that the only existing exemptions to the asbestos ban, chrysotile fibres, will also be removed by this deadline. There are currently only two exemptions for chrysotile-containing diaphragms for electrolysis operations: one chlor-alkali factory in Sweden and another one in Germany. WebApr 5, 2024 · The EPA recently proposed a ban of chrysotile asbestos in the United States. This is the first attempt by the EPA to ban asbestos since the enacted ban in the 1980s. The EPA claims chrysotile asbestos is the only type still imported into the country. Chrysotile asbestos is the most common type of the mineral.
